1. Expansion of Virtual Care Platforms

With the increasing demand for remote consultations, several healthcare providers are expanding their telehealth platforms. These virtual care solutions allow patients to connect with healthcare professionals from the comfort of their homes, reducing travel time and associated costs. Enhanced features, such as integrated patient health records and customizable appointment scheduling, improve the ease of access for users.

2. AI and Machine Learning Integration

The integration of art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ning in telehealth applications is transforming patient diagnostics and treatment plans. By analyzing patient data, these technologies can assist in providing personalized healthcare recommendations, thus improving the overall patient experience.

3. Enhanced Remote Monitoring Tools

Innovations in remote monitoring tools have made it easier for healthcare providers to track patients’ health metrics in real-time. Wearable devices and mobile health apps now allow for continuous monitoring of vital signs, which can be crucial for patients with chronic conditions. This data-driven approach enhances patient engagement and improves clinical outcomes.

4. Improved Regulatory Frameworks

As telehealth continues to grow, regulatory bodies are adapting to the changes by establishing guidelines that broaden the scope of telemedicine. These improved frameworks facilitate reimbursement for virtual visits and ensure patient data security, fostering greater trust in these digital healthcare solutions.
